I have a master detail page setup. When I select a row and then click on edit, it display data from the correct row. If I select another row after that, it shows the data from the first row. I do have reload after submit set to true, and I'm using the default, jqGrid created form. The data is being saved to the server after clicking submit.

Just an observation, not a solution, but when the row is selected it sets aria-selected="true", when the next row is selected/clicked it adds aria-selected="true" to that row as well and does not remove the aria-selected="true" from the previous/other row(s).

Could you please download the latest from GitHub and test. There was a bug in setSelection when we have special chars as id.
